TV SPARC CUBE
- T-Thirst
- V-Vomiting
- S-Sweating
- P-Pulse weak
- A-Anxious
- R-Respirations shallow/rapid
- C-Cool
- C-Cyanotic
- U-Unconscious
- B-BP low
- E-Eyes blank
